Is Nintendo 2DS discontinued?

The Nintendo 2DS is a handheld game console produced by Nintendo. The Nintendo 2DS was discontinued in Japan in 2019 and in the rest of the world in 2020.

Is the 2DS region locked?

Yes, the Nintendo 3DS, Nintendo 3DS XL, Nintendo 2DS, New Nintendo 3DS, New Nintendo 3DS XL, and New Nintendo 2DS XL systems are region locked. Region locking enables Nintendo to include parental controls and more efficiently deliver region-specific system and menu updates to users.

Can you use Japanese 2DS in USA?

What the difference between this one and the 2ds xl ? The 2DS LL is Japanese region (and language)-locked and plays Japanese games only. The 2DS XL is U.S./Canada region-locked and plays U.S./Canada games only.

Can 2DS ll play US games?

Like the Nintendo 3DS before it, the new 2DS is region-locked, which, unfortunately, means that devices can only play games with the same region codes, and you can’t access online stores from different regions. Since Japan is a whole different region than North America, you can’t play North American games on it.
